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40046767618 4467353730 31884169542 152492704 4358139641
4020111976 380440328 14
4020111976 380440328 14
1949 9655 01285871348 562878415
All about undefined
Interested in learning more?
4020111976 380440328 14
1949 9655 01285871348 562878415
See more
3668854 7211074 36711
804792950 503 4585453
See more
25243672 9397 08
39990652 253 663583392
See more